Important to known
- The islands are open to visitors from October 15 to May 15.
- Child ticket: 4-11 years old. Free for children under 3 years old without a seat on the bus and boat.
- The program may change due to weather conditions or other unforeseen circumstances.
- Pregnant women, children under 1 year old, and individuals with back or neck problems are not allowed on the tour.
- Alcohol consumption is prohibited on the islands (fine of 1 000 baht).
- In case of cancellation or rescheduling, regardless of the circumstances, the National Park charges a fee of 1 000 baht per person.
